Bhagavad Gita 2:19-20 - The Eternal Soul
HinduismBhagavad Gita 2:19-20
Krishna's teaching on the indestructible nature of the soul follows a chiastic movement from death to the eternal Self.
AThose who believe the soul to be slayable and those who think it can slay are both deceived.
BThe soul cannot be cut by weapons, burned by fire, wetted by water, or withered by the wind.
CThe soul is eternal, immutable, and beyond all destruction.
B'Therefore, knowing this, you should not grieve for any creature.
A'Perform your duty without attachment, and you will attain the highest peace.
